Web11 de ago. de 2024 · Updated on August 11, 2024. All spiders, from the tiniest jumping spider to the largest tarantula, have the same general life cycle. They mature in three stages: egg, spiderling, and adult. Though the details of each stage vary from one species to another, they are all very similar. WebSize range. Spiders range in body length from 0.5 to about 90 mm (0.02–3.5 inches).
